The Silent Patient by Alex Michaelides
dark
mysterious
tense
medium-paced
- Plot- or character-driven? A mix
- Strong character development? It's complicated
- Loveable characters? No
- Diverse cast of characters? No
- Flaws of characters a main focus? Yes
3.25
Interesting plot with a decent twist as promised by my bookish friends. I was not a fan of the main narrator nor many of the other characters. I wonder if being a horror fan curbed the shock of the climax and twist because while I didn't quite predict it, I wasn't as surprised as I wanted to be.
Tristan Strong Destroys The World by Kwame Mbalia
adventurous
funny
inspiring
medium-paced
- Plot- or character-driven? A mix
- Strong character development? Yes
- Loveable characters? Yes
- Diverse cast of characters? Yes
- Flaws of characters a main focus? Yes
5.0
A great continuation of the Strong trilogy! The adventure continues with old and new faces. Although the conflict isn't quite new, I found that Mbalia gave it fresh life with the mystery and process to get to the climax of the story. It leaves on a cliffhanger, but our protagonist,Tristan, seems to have come into his potential and is ready to face the big bad once and for all.
